Referring to fig. 1 to 7, the embodiment of the utility model provides a ceiling lamp with air sterilization and purification functions mainly includes jib 1, ceiling lamp main part and installs the plasma purification device 3 in the ceiling lamp main part, and the ceiling lamp main part includes fixing base 11, the connecting pipe 12 of being connected with fixing base 11, is connected the one end of keeping away from fixing base 11 with connecting pipe 12 and is fixed with lamp shade 13, is equipped with light-emitting component in the lamp shade 13, and plasma purification device 3 connects the lower extreme at fixing base 11. The plasma purification device 3 comprises a shell 32, a plasma purification module 33 and a fan assembly 34 which are arranged in the shell 32, wherein an air inlet part 35 is arranged on the side wall of the shell 32, an air outlet part 31 is arranged at the front end of the shell 32, and the plasma purification module 33 and the fan assembly 34 are arranged in the shell 32 and are positioned between the air inlet part 35 and the air outlet part 31.
Plasma purification device 3 installs and is connected with fixing base 11 lower extreme and is fixed with front end open-ended bobbin case 2 in, 2 rear ends of bobbin case are equipped with the connector, and the connector inner wall is equipped with the internal thread, and 11 lower extreme outer walls of fixing base are equipped with the external screw thread, and bobbin case 2 passes through threaded connection to be fixed at the lower extreme of fixing base 11.
An annular flange 22 is arranged on the inner wall of the cylinder shell 2, an annular groove is arranged on the annular flange 22, and two sides of the annular flange 22 incline towards the direction of the annular groove in an arc surface manner and are used for guiding the elastic plunger to slide into the annular groove. The side of the shell 32 of the plasma purification device 3 is fixed with at least two elastic plungers, the marble 36 of the elastic plungers protrudes out of the side surface of the shell 32, the plasma purification device 3 is clamped with the annular flange 22 of the cylinder shell 2 through the elastic plungers, the elastic plungers are clamped into the annular groove of the annular flange 22, the marble 36 can slide along the annular groove, the overall structure of the ceiling lamp is simple, the plasma purification device 3 is convenient to disassemble and assemble, and the plasma purification device 3 is easy to clean.
The plasma purification device 3 comprises a shell 32, a plasma purification module 33 and a fan assembly 34 which are arranged in the shell 32, wherein the plasma purification module 33 is provided with an air inlet part 35 on the side wall of the shell 32, the drum shell 2 is provided with an outer air inlet part 21 communicated with the air inlet part 35, the front end of the shell 32 is provided with an air outlet part 31, and the plasma purification module 33 and the fan assembly 34 are arranged in the shell 32 and are positioned between the air inlet part 35 and the air outlet part 31. The plasma purification module 33 can ionize air to generate an electric field, so that a large amount of negative ions and ozone are generated and released in the air, and the negative ions released in the air can refresh the air, which is beneficial to human bodies.
The bottom is equipped with the bottom plate in the barrel casing 2, be fixed with two-layer lantern ring 23 on the bottom plate, be fixed with the protruding 37 of ring that suits with lantern ring 23 at plasma purifier 3's casing rear end, plasma purifier 3 and barrel casing 2 joint, ring is protruding 37 to stretch into in the lantern ring 23, be equipped with at least one metal contact 24 on the lateral wall of lantern ring 23, be equipped with annular concave surface 38 on the protruding 37 lateral wall of ring, the laminating has the sheetmetal on concave surface 38, make metal contact 24 be located concave surface 38, and metal contact 24 and sheetmetal contact, metal contact 24 and power cord electric connection, sheetmetal and plasma purifier 3's electric wire electric connection, the electric connection between plasma purifier 3 and the power cord is realized with the sheetmetal contact to metal contact 24. The plasma purification device 3 is clamped with the cylinder shell 2, and the plasma purification device 3 can rotate along the annular flange 22 in the cylinder shell 2 under the condition of normal operation.
Plasma purifier 3 passes through elasticity plunger and 2 joints of cartridge case, and stretches into the lantern ring 23 through the ring is protruding 37 and realize that plasma purifier 3 is connected with the electricity of power, but plasma purifier 3 all the joint go into cartridge case 2 in arbitrary angle, the joint position need not to aim at, directly impress in the cartridge case 2 can for plasma purifier 3 and hang tearing open between the lamp, adorn more conveniently, make things convenient for plasma purifier 2's washing.
The air outlet part 31 of the plasma purification device 3 is an air outlet cover and is fixedly connected with the front end of the shell 32, and the edge of the front end of the air outlet cover protrudes out of the cylindrical shell 2, so that the plasma purification device 3 can be conveniently pulled out of the cylindrical shell 2 by holding the air outlet cover with hands.
When the ceiling lamp and the plasma purification device 3 are used, the power switch is turned on, the ceiling lamp and the plasma purification device 3 work normally, the plasma purification module 33 ionizes air to generate an electric field, and further generate a large amount of negative ions and ozone, the negative ions and the ozone are released in the air and generate strong oxidation reaction with microorganisms and organic particles in the air to destroy ribonucleic acid, deoxyribonucleic acid or other active characteristics of the negative ions and the ozone, so that the negative ions and the ozone lose activity, and therefore the purposes of disinfection, deodorization, and removal of part of organic matters such as formaldehyde are achieved.

Claims (6)

1. A ceiling lamp with air sterilization and purification functions is characterized by comprising a hoisting assembly, a ceiling lamp main body and a plasma purification device arranged on the ceiling lamp main body, wherein the plasma purification device is connected to the lower end of the ceiling lamp main body; the lower end of the ceiling lamp main body is provided with a cylinder shell, the plasma purification device is arranged in the cylinder shell, and the cylinder shell is provided with an outer air inlet part; an annular groove is formed in the inner wall of the cylinder shell, at least two elastic plungers are fixed on the side face of the shell of the plasma purification device, marbles of the elastic plungers protrude out of the side surface of the shell, and the elastic plungers slide into the annular groove to enable the plasma purification device to be clamped in the cylinder shell;
the plasma purification device is characterized in that two layers of lantern rings are arranged at the center of the bottom in the barrel shell, a ring protrusion which is matched with the lantern rings one by one is fixed at the rear end of the shell of the plasma purification device, at least one metal contact which is electrically connected with a ceiling lamp power line is arranged on the inner side wall of the lantern ring, an annular concave surface which is corresponding to the metal contact is arranged on the outer side wall of the ring protrusion, a metal sheet which is electrically connected with a wire of the plasma purification device is attached to the inner side of the annular concave surface, the ring protrusion extends into the lantern rings, the metal contact is located in the annular concave surface, and the metal contact is in contact with the metal sheet.
2. A ceiling lamp with air sterilizing and purifying functions as claimed in claim 1, wherein the plasma purifying device comprises a housing, a plasma purifying module and a fan assembly installed in the housing, an air inlet portion communicated with the outer air inlet portion is provided on the side wall of the housing, an air outlet portion is provided at the front end of the housing, the air outlet portion faces the front end opening of the cylindrical shell, and the plasma purifying module and the fan assembly are installed in the housing at a position between the air inlet portion and the air outlet portion.
3. The ceiling lamp with air sterilization and purification functions as claimed in claim 2, wherein the air outlet part is an air outlet cover and is fixedly connected with the front end of the housing, and the edge of the front end of the air outlet cover protrudes out of the cylindrical shell.
4. The ceiling lamp with the air sterilization and purification functions according to claim 1, 2 or 3, wherein the ceiling lamp main body comprises a fixed seat and connecting pipes connected with the fixed seat, one end of each connecting pipe, which is far away from the fixed seat, is fixed with a light emitting assembly, and the cylinder shell is connected with the lower end of the fixed seat.
5. The ceiling lamp with the air sterilization and purification function according to claim 4, wherein the cylindrical shell is provided with a connection port, the inner wall of the connection port is provided with an internal thread, the outer wall of the lower end of the fixed seat is provided with an external thread, and the cylindrical shell is fixed at the lower end of the fixed seat through threaded connection.
6. The ceiling lamp with the air sterilization and purification function according to claim 1, 2 or 3, wherein an annular flange is arranged on the inner wall of the cylinder shell, and the annular groove is arranged on the surface of the annular flange opposite to the elastic plunger.
